Handover Note — from Callum Brayfield to Imogen Vask

Imogen, here's where things stand on the Southreach expansion. The Tylverton warehouse lease is agreed in principle, and finance has the capex model drafted. Two local hires are pending approval. Keep an eye on the currency hedging assumptions — they're optimistic. The confidential business-plan note you'll need is appended just below this line.

management briefing: Gross margin on Ralael came in at 15 percent against a plan of 10 percent. Only 9 of the 100 pilot accounts renewed Ralael, so a churn review is set for April 1.

## Queuewright v4.2 — log compaction

Compaction finally landed for topic logs. Old segments with superseded keys get merged nightly, cutting disk use by roughly 60% on the busiest brokers. Tombstones are retained for seven days before purge. Nothing changes for consumers. Compaction-related pages this week should go straight to the engineer below.

named custodian: Brivan Eliath Quenox Frador

# Contacts: Proctoring Queue

The Examgate proctoring queue is owned by the Assessment Platform team. Queue stalls: page the on-call via the usual rotation. Capacity changes: file a ticket, two-day lead time. Schema changes to session events need sign-off from both Platform and the Kestrel ingest team. Bring open items to the weekly sync. Non-urgent queue questions go to the address below.

escalation mailbox, yafog-kafof: eliok@xolmarcloud.local